NASA Astrophysics, Commercial Satellites Launch on SpaceX Rideshare Mission
NewsJan 11, 2026

NASA Astrophysics, Commercial Satellites Launch on SpaceX Rideshare Mission

SpaceX’s Falcon 9 "Twilight" rideshare launched on Jan. 11 from Vandenberg, deploying 40 spacecraft into a dusk‑dawn sun‑synchronous orbit. The manifest included three NASA astrophysics cubesats—SPARCS, BlackCAT and Pandora—alongside commercial constellations from Kepler Communications, Spire, Plan‑S, Hawkeye 360, Capella Space, ICEYE and Umbra....

NDSS 2025 – EMIRIS: Eavesdropping On Iris Information Via Electromagnetic Side Channel
NewsJan 11, 2026

NDSS 2025 – EMIRIS: Eavesdropping On Iris Information Via Electromagnetic Side Channel

Researchers at Shandong University presented EMIRIS at NDSS 2025, demonstrating that electromagnetic emissions from near‑infrared iris sensors can be captured and used to reconstruct iris patterns. “Motivational Brake” Could Point to Schizophrenia and Depression Treatments
NewsJan 11, 2026

“Motivational Brake” Could Point to Schizophrenia and Depression Treatments

Researchers at Kyoto University identified a ventral striatum‑to‑ventral pallidum (VS‑VP) circuit that functions as a "motivation brake" suppressing action initiation under stressful conditions.
